Sorry for skipping the template but this issue is quite simple to describe:
I had this with the latest release and the devlopment master
Secure your Elasticsearch instance and only allow TLS connections
Give a CA certificate to the Elasticsearch module
Forget to set permissions for allowing your webserver access to the CA certificate
You only get an ugly stack trace without a hint that the certificate file is unreadable.
Since some people use configuration management for configuring Elasticsearch, it's quite common to use a certificate from somewhere in the filesystem. And that tend's to lead to disaster.
